Understanding Accident Injury Claims
When someone is injured due to another celebration's neglect, they may be entitled to compensation for their injuries. This compensation can cover medical expenditures, lost earnings, discomfort and suffering, and more. Nevertheless, the legal process can be difficult, and it's necessary to comprehend the essential elements involved.
The Steps to Filing a Claim
Below is a table detailing the important steps in filing an accident injury claim:
| Step | Description |
|---|---|
| 1. Look For Medical Attention | Ensure that you receive immediate treatment for your injuries. Focus on your healing first. |
| 2. File the Incident | Collect proof, consisting of pictures, witness declarations, and police reports. |
| 3. Consult a Lawyer | Seek professional legal advice from a qualified accident attorney. |
| 4. Sue | Your attorney will help you officially submit a claim with the insurer. |
| 5. Work out Settlement | Take part in settlements with the insurance business for a fair settlement. |
| 6. Pursue Litigation (if needed) | If a settlement can not be reached, your attorney may recommend submitting a lawsuit. |
Kinds Of Accident Injury Cases
Accident injury claims can develop from different scenarios. Understanding the different types can help victims recognize their scenario and look for suitable legal advice. Here's a list of typical kinds of accident injury cases:
Car Accidents: These involve accidents in between cars and may include cases of negligence, sidetracked driving, or driving under the impact.
Slip and Fall Incidents: Property owners have a duty to maintain safe environments. Injuries sustained due to dangerous conditions may lead to premises liability claims.
Workplace Injuries: Employees hurt on the task might submit claims for employees' compensation or seek legal action against negligent 3rd celebrations.
Medical Malpractice: Injuries resulting from the carelessness of healthcare specialists can cause malpractice claims.
Item Liability: Injuries triggered by defective products might result in claims against manufacturers or sellers.
Common Misconceptions About Personal Injury Claims
There are numerous misconceptions surrounding accident injury declares that can misguide victims. Here's a list of the most common mistaken beliefs:
You Don't Need a Lawyer: While it's possible to deal with a claim separately, an attorney can provide valuable assistance and boost your possibilities of getting fair compensation.
All Claims Go to Court: Most personal injury claims are settled out of court. Litigation is normally a last hope when settlements fail.
You Will Automatically Receive Compensation: Compensation is not guaranteed; victims need to develop liability and show the extent of their injuries.
You Can Wait to File a Claim: Most jurisdictions impose statutes of constraints that limit the time frame for submitting claims. Delaying might jeopardize your ability to pursue compensation.
Frequently Asked Questions About Accident Injury Claims
What Should I Do Immediately After an Accident?
After an accident, prioritize your health. Seek medical attention, record the occurrence, and collect details from witnesses. This early paperwork will be essential for your claim.
The length of time Do I Have to File a Claim?
The time limitation for suing differs by state. Usually, it ranges from one to three years. Seek advice from a lawyer as quickly as possible to ensure you meet all due dates.
Can I Still File a Claim if I Was Partially at Fault?
Yes, in lots of jurisdictions, you can still submit a claim if you were partially at fault, however your compensation may be reduced based upon your percentage of fault.
What Compensation Can I Expect?
Compensation differs extensively based upon individual scenarios but can consist of medical expenses, lost wages, discomfort and suffering, and future medical costs. Your attorney can supply a clearer price quote based upon your case.
Just how much Does It Cost to Hire a Personal Injury Lawyer?
The majority of accident lawyers work on a contingency charge basis, meaning they only get paid if you win your case. This cost usually represents a percentage of the settlement quantity.
The Role of a Personal Injury Attorney
Employing a personal injury attorney can substantially affect the outcome of your case. Here are numerous essential roles they play:
Legal Expertise: Attorneys have thorough knowledge of accident law and can navigate the complexities of your case.
Insurance Negotiation: They can manage negotiations with insurance companies, guaranteeing your rights are protected which you receive fair compensation.
Case Preparation: Attorneys collect evidence, interview witnesses, and prepare necessary paperwork to support your claim.
Court Representation: If your case goes to trial, having a lawyer skilled in lawsuits can be vital in presenting your case effectively.
